How to delete some of the "Purpose" entries from the drop down list in mileage tracker?

I would like to delete some of the Purpose entries from the mileage tracker.  Canadian Edition, 2018 Home & Biz, Windows 10 - All up to date.  Thank you for your time.

    Well, I found an easy way to delete my "Destinations" and "Purposes" of my choice!  It worked/benefited me, as I also have proof of my mileage, etc in my hardcopy Planner.  Anyhow, I just went to my earliest year of using the Mileage Tracker in Quicken (which is only 2017) and clicked Edit to any trip that had a Destination and/or Purpose that I wanted to delete or rename, by just deleting the text and leaving the field blank.  After I was done, I went back to my current 2018 mileage tracker to "add" a trip, and the drop-down list showed only the options that I purposely kept.  This may not be a good option for everyone, but I just wanted to share.
